Para habilitar o CORS no NGINX, você precisa usar a diretiva add_header e adicioná-la ao arquivo de configuração NGINX apropriado. para permitir o acesso de qualquer domínio.
- O que é Cors em nginx?
- Foi bloqueado pela política CORS Nginx?
- O que é Access-Control-allow-Origin Nginx?
- Como faço para ativar o CORS no localhost?
- Como você corrige o problema CORS no nginx?
- Para que Nginx é usado?
- Como faço para habilitar CORS no servidor Nginx?
- Como faço para ativar o CORS no proxy nginx?
- Por que o Cors é necessário?
- Como funciona o Cors?
- Como faço para iniciar o Nginx no Linux?
- Como faço para habilitar a política CORS no Apache?
O que é Cors em nginx?
CORS, também conhecido como compartilhamento de recursos de origem cruzada, é uma técnica usada em navegadores modernos que controla o acesso a recursos hospedados em um servidor web. O CORS usa cabeçalhos adicionais, como origin, access-control-origin e muitos mais para determinar se o recurso solicitado tem permissão para ser enviado ao navegador.
Foi bloqueado pela política CORS Nginx?
Nginx: bloqueado pela política CORS: o cabeçalho 'Access-Control-Allow-Origin' contém vários valores. ... Faça com que o servidor envie o cabeçalho com um valor válido ou, se uma resposta opaca atender às suas necessidades, defina o modo da solicitação como 'no-cors' para buscar o recurso com CORS desativado.
O que é Access-Control-allow-Origin Nginx?
Como você pode ver por Access-Control-Allow-Origin * - esta é uma configuração totalmente aberta, o que significa que qualquer cliente será capaz de acessar o recurso. Há um conceito um pouco confuso de solicitações CORS simples e pré-voo (consulte as especificações detalhadas dos cors). ...
Como faço para ativar o CORS no localhost?
Use a configuração de proxy em Create React App
"proxy": "https: // cat-fact.herokuapp.com / ", agora, quando você faz uma solicitação de API para https: // localhost: 3000 / api / fatos, Criar aplicativo React fará o proxy da solicitação de API para https: // cat-fact.herokuapp.com / fatos e o erro CORS serão resolvidos.
Como você corrige o problema CORS no nginx?
Para habilitar o CORS no NGINX, você precisa usar a diretiva add_header e adicioná-la ao arquivo de configuração NGINX apropriado. para permitir o acesso de qualquer domínio.
Para que Nginx é usado?
NGINX é um software de código aberto para serviço da Web, proxy reverso, cache, balanceamento de carga, streaming de mídia e muito mais. Ele começou como um servidor web projetado para máximo desempenho e estabilidade.
Como faço para habilitar CORS no servidor Nginx?
Para permitir CORS no NGINX, você precisa adicionar a diretiva add_header Access-Control-Allow-Origin no bloco do servidor da configuração do servidor NGINX ou arquivo host virtual.
Como faço para ativar o CORS no proxy nginx?
Vamos enganar o navegador substituindo o cabeçalho Access-Control-Allow-Origin.
- servico de localização
- proxy_pass http: // host.docker.interno: 3000;
- proxy_set_header Origem http: // myfrontend.com: 3000;
- proxy_hide_header Access-Control-Allow-Origin;
- add_header Access-Control-Allow-Origin $ http_origin;
Por que o Cors é necessário?
CORS é uma forma de permitir solicitações ao seu servidor da web de determinados locais, especificando cabeçalhos de resposta como 'Access-Control-Allow-Origin'. É um protocolo importante para possibilitar solicitações entre domínios, nos casos em que haja uma necessidade legítima de fazê-lo.
Como funciona o Cors?
O CORS também depende de um mecanismo pelo qual os navegadores fazem uma solicitação de "comprovação" ao servidor que hospeda o recurso de origem cruzada, a fim de verificar se o servidor permitirá a solicitação real. ... O mecanismo CORS suporta solicitações seguras de origem cruzada e transferências de dados entre navegadores e servidores.
Como faço para iniciar o Nginx no Linux?
Instalação
- Faça login em seu (ve) servidor via SSH como usuário root. ssh root @ hostname.
- Use apt-get para atualizar seu (ve) servidor. ...
- Instale o nginx. ...
- Por padrão, o nginx não inicia automaticamente, então você precisa usar o seguinte comando. ...
- Teste o nginx apontando seu navegador para seu nome de domínio ou endereço IP.
Como faço para habilitar a política CORS no Apache?
Como habilitar CORS no Apache Web Server
- Habilitar módulo de cabeçalhos. Você precisa habilitar o módulo de cabeçalhos para habilitar CORS no Apache. ...
- Habilitar CORS no Apache. Em seguida, adicione a diretiva “Header add Access-Control-Allow-Origin *” ao seu arquivo de configuração do Apache ou . ...
- Reinicie o servidor Apache.